Congratulations, folks. We've endured such "Terrible Thursday" games as Browns-Ravens, Cardinals-Rams, Chiefs-Chargers and Dolphins-Bills among others. Yeesh! Well, this NFC South tilt in Atlanta should be a dandy.
However, New Orleans (one of six NFC teams with 5-6 or 6-5 marks) is the only team to beat Atlanta this season and has won four straight vs. the Falcons. Drew Brees has won 11 of 13 vs. Atlanta since joining the Saints in 2006.
I think this is a field-goal game either way. So give me the more desperate team and the points. Oh yeah: If it comes down to overtime, skip the extra quarter and have tight ends Jimmy Graham and Tony Gonzalez, both former college hoopsters, compete in a dunk-off on the goal posts.
THE PICK: Saints
